Q:
How do you switch handle sides?
Answer: The above answer is correct. Unscrew and remove the cap on the non-handle side. Remove the screw you will find under the cap. Also remove the plastic sheath the screw goes into. On the handle side, remove the large screw. The handle will come off. Pull out the "shaft" the handle was screwed into. Put the shaft into the empty hole on the other side, then screw the handle into it. The plastic insert and other screw go in where the handle was. It can be pretty tight pushing the plastic shaft in even after aliging the edges of the hexagonal shaft.

! : NOT worth buying
Arrived in a timely fashion. Casts somewhat smoothly, but it does make some extra noises when retrieving. This one is a replacement for the Zebco Z02PRO which I lost overboard when the pins did not release the line properly during a cast. I thought the Zebco was a bit smoother, but it did have that one fatal flaw.
UPDATE: June2017. My review has changed with this 1st time out fishing this year. The line spool (which moves up and down along the main shaft) has begun to have a pronounced tilt on the shaft as it moves. This results in a rub against the bottom surface of the pickup rotor assembly with each crank rotation, and in a bit of resistance in the turning of the crank each turn. Lubrication of parts is sufficient, but it appears that the fit of the Spool is just sloppy on the main shaft. I believe that the "extra noises" which I had mentioned in my 1st review last Autumn were directly related to this problem.
Based on that problem, I would not recommend this reel.
